An antique light fixture, characterized by its verdant hue and design indicative of a past era, can serve as both a functional object and a decorative element. Such an item may feature a glass shade, a ceramic base, or metallic components, all exhibiting a distinctive green coloration achieved through various methods, like applied paint, colored glass, or patinated metal. This type of lighting frequently appears in interior design, contributing to aesthetics ranging from mid-century modern to eclectic.

The significance of these older light sources extends beyond mere illumination. They offer a tangible connection to design trends of earlier periods, providing insight into past manufacturing techniques and stylistic preferences. The presence of an emerald-toned, period-specific luminaire can enhance a space’s ambiance, offering a sense of nostalgia and individuality. Moreover, the acquisition of such pieces often supports sustainable practices through the reuse and appreciation of existing objects, contrasting with the environmental impact of new production.

Guidance on Acquiring and Maintaining Antique Emerald Luminaires

The following guidance provides insights into selecting and preserving antique light fixtures with verdant coloration, intended for collectors and those interested in incorporating vintage elements into interior design.

Tip 1: Authentication Requires Scrutiny. Prior to purchase, verify the purported age and origin of the item. Consult reputable sources, examine manufacturer’s marks, and compare the fixture to documented examples of similar pieces from the relevant period.

Tip 2: Assess Condition Meticulously. Evaluate the structural integrity of the frame, wiring, and shade. Note any evidence of damage, such as cracks, chips, or corrosion. Factor in the cost of potential repairs when determining value.

Tip 3: Research Restoration Practices. If restoration is desired, identify qualified professionals experienced in preserving antique lighting. Improper techniques can diminish the value and authenticity of the piece.

Tip 4: Prioritize Electrical Safety. Due to potential deterioration of original wiring, professional rewiring is often recommended to ensure safe operation and compliance with modern electrical standards.

Tip 5: Opt for Period-Appropriate Bulbs. Utilizing bulb styles and wattages consistent with the lamp’s original design enhances the aesthetic appeal and prevents overheating that could damage the shade or fixture.

Tip 6: Preserve the Original Finish When Possible. Avoid harsh cleaning agents that could strip the original patina or paint. Gentle cleaning with a soft cloth is generally sufficient to remove dust and surface dirt.

Tip 7: Consider Display Environment. Position the fixture in a location that minimizes exposure to direct sunlight or excessive humidity to prevent fading or corrosion of the green finish.

The mindful acquisition and maintenance of these light sources ensures their longevity and preserves their historical and aesthetic value.

1. Color Consistency

1. Color Consistency, Vintage Lamps

Color consistency is a crucial factor in evaluating the aesthetic appeal and authenticity of antique verdant lamps. Discrepancies in color can indicate repairs, replacements, or inconsistencies in manufacturing, impacting the lamp’s value and historical accuracy. Uniformity in hue, saturation, and tone across various components is generally desirable.

  • Original Dye Batch Integrity

    The initial fabrication process often involved a single dye or pigmentation batch for all colored components. Consistent coloration throughout the shade, base, and any decorative elements suggests the original composition remains intact. Variations may indicate that a component is not original to the lamp or was produced at a different time.

  • Fading and UV Exposure

    Prolonged exposure to ultraviolet radiation can differentially affect pigments and dyes, leading to uneven fading. Shades oriented toward sunlight may exhibit lighter tones than the base, shielded from direct light. Evaluating the consistency of the green hue across exposed and sheltered areas helps assess the degree of environmental impact on the lamp’s color.

  • Material-Specific Pigmentation

    Different materials, such as glass, ceramic, and metal, require distinct pigmentation processes. Even within the same manufacturing period, slight variations in color are possible due to the chemical properties of each material. Assessing whether the variations fall within acceptable tolerances for the era and material is key to determining color consistency.

  • Repair and Restoration Inconsistencies

    Previous repairs or restorations often involve replacing or refinishing components. Matching the original green hue can be challenging, resulting in noticeable color differences. Evaluating the skill and accuracy of any color-matching efforts during restoration is vital for determining the impact on the lamp’s authenticity and aesthetic value.

2. Material Integrity

2. Material Integrity, Vintage Lamps

The structural soundness of components in antique verdant lighting fixtures is intrinsically linked to its longevity, functionality, and aesthetic value. Deterioration of materials can compromise the lamp’s structural integrity, leading to instability, electrical hazards, and a decline in visual appeal. The selection and preservation of original materials are paramount in maintaining its overall state. Consider, for example, a vintage emerald glass lamp with a leaded base; corrosion of the lead over time weakens the structural support, potentially causing the glass shade to crack or detach. Similarly, a metal lamp with a painted verdant finish can experience rust if the underlying metal is compromised, leading to paint chipping and further degradation. Material stability is critical, therefore, assessing for signs of stress such as cracks, rust, or delamination provides insight into its condition and future serviceability.

Real-world examples illustrate the significance of material integrity in these antique lighting pieces. A ceramic-based emerald lamp, if exposed to prolonged moisture, can develop micro-fractures, leading to structural failure. Another instance is the aging of original wiring, wherein the insulation becomes brittle and poses a significant electrical hazard. Addressing these issues through professional restoration, using period-appropriate replacement materials when necessary, becomes vital for preserving its operational integrity. Moreover, understanding material composition is essential. A shade crafted from a specific type of colored glass might exhibit unique properties, making it susceptible to certain cleaning agents or handling techniques; incorrect maintenance can permanently damage its coloration or structure.

In conclusion, material integrity is a cornerstone of these lighting pieces. Recognizing potential vulnerabilities in the original components is essential for their long-term preservation and functionality. Investing in appropriate conservation efforts, which may include stabilization, repair, or sensitive replacement of components, ensures its continuing service as both a functional light source and an aesthetically valuable antique item. 3. Design Authenticity

3. Design Authenticity, Vintage Lamps

Design authenticity, in the context of antique light fixtures with verdant coloration, represents a confluence of stylistic, manufacturing, and historical accuracy. Establishing a piece’s design integrity requires rigorous examination and informed judgment, influencing its market value and historical significance.

  • Stylistic Conformance

    Authenticity hinges on adherence to the design principles characteristic of the period the lamp purports to represent. Mid-century modern examples, for instance, should exhibit clean lines, geometric forms, and a minimalist aesthetic. Deviations from these norms raise questions about the fixture’s originality or potential alterations. Example: a purported Art Deco green lamp displaying Victorian-era floral motifs would be deemed stylistically inauthentic.

  • Material and Construction Consistency

    The materials employed and the construction techniques used must align with accepted practices of the era. A fixture claiming 1920s origin should not feature plastic components, as this material was not widely used in lamp manufacturing at that time. Similarly, machine-made components on a piece attributed to an earlier, pre-industrial period would indicate inauthenticity.

  • Manufacturer’s Mark and Documentation

    The presence of a legitimate manufacturer’s mark or associated documentation, such as original catalogs or advertisements, significantly bolsters a lamp’s claim to authenticity. These markings provide verifiable links to a specific manufacturer and timeframe. Absence of such evidence necessitates a more thorough investigation of stylistic and material cues. Example: A Steuben mark on a green art glass lamp would provide strong evidence of authenticity.

  • Patina and Wear Patterns

    Authentic pieces often exhibit natural patina and wear patterns commensurate with their age. While artificial distressing techniques can mimic these effects, close examination can often reveal inconsistencies. Genuine wear tends to be subtle and distributed in areas of typical use, such as switch mechanisms or the base of the lamp.

4. Historical Period

4. Historical Period, Vintage Lamps

The historical period fundamentally shapes the design, materials, and functionality of any antique light fixture, particularly those exhibiting a verdant coloration. Understanding the era of origin provides critical context for assessing authenticity, value, and appropriate restoration techniques.

  • Art Nouveau (1890-1910)

    Green glass lamps from this period frequently feature organic, flowing lines and motifs inspired by nature, such as leaves, vines, and flowers. Favrile glass, often iridescent, was a common material. Examples include Tiffany Studios lamps with green-toned shades depicting natural scenes. The green hues tend to be soft and muted, reflecting the period’s aesthetic preferences. The presence of these elements can aid in confirming the historical period of these lamps.

  • Art Deco (1920-1930s)

    The Art Deco era embraced geometric shapes, bold colors, and luxurious materials. Green lamps of this period often showcase streamlined designs, with stepped bases and shades featuring stylized patterns. Emerald green and jadeite glass were popular choices. Consider a skyscraper-shaped lamp with a jade green glass shade. Lamps of this era often incorporate materials such as chrome or Bakelite, which can help identify the lamp’s historical period.

  • Mid-Century Modern (1940s-1960s)

    Mid-Century Modern lamps often display minimalist designs, clean lines, and a focus on functionality. Green hues ranged from avocado to olive, reflecting the era’s color palette. Materials included wood, metal, and fiberglass. An example would be a gooseneck desk lamp with an olive green shade. These lamps, during this time, commonly possess features that are consistent with the Mid-Century Modern style. This can assist you in pinpointing the lamp’s historical period.

  • Victorian Era (1837-1901)

    Lamps from the Victorian era often showcase ornate designs, intricate details, and a sense of opulence. Green glass shades might feature hand-painted decorations or textured surfaces. Table lamps with brass or bronze bases were common. An example would be an oil lamp converted to electricity, featuring a hand-painted green glass shade depicting floral motifs. These stylistic choices are unique to the Victorian era and can help to determine a lamp’s origin.

The historical period serves as a crucial lens through which to evaluate the design, materials, and construction of these verdant lighting pieces. Recognizing the specific characteristics associated with each era enables collectors and enthusiasts to make informed assessments of authenticity and value, thereby preserving the historical legacy embodied in these decorative objects.

5. Functional Condition

5. Functional Condition, Vintage Lamps

The functional condition of a green vintage lamp directly influences its value, safety, and usability. Illumination capability, switch mechanism efficacy, and wiring integrity are critical aspects. A malfunctioning switch, for example, renders the lamp inoperable, diminishing its practical value despite its aesthetic appeal. Deteriorated wiring poses a significant fire hazard, demanding immediate attention and potential restoration. A green vintage lamp lacking functional reliability, irrespective of its aesthetic charm, presents both a safety risk and a compromised user experience. This highlights the fundamental importance of functional condition in the overall assessment of these vintage items.

Restoration efforts frequently prioritize functional improvements. Rewiring with modern, insulated wires ensures safe operation, while replacing damaged sockets and switches restores functionality. However, preserving the original appearance during restoration is crucial. For instance, utilizing cloth-covered wiring that mimics the original material maintains aesthetic authenticity while enhancing safety. Addressing structural issues, such as a wobbly base or a loose shade holder, further contributes to its usability. The goal is to balance aesthetic preservation with functional improvement, ensuring the lamp remains both visually appealing and practically useful.

In summary, the functional condition of these light sources represents a critical component of their overall value and desirability. Addressing deficiencies through appropriate restoration techniques ensures both safety and usability, while carefully balancing the need for functional improvement with the preservation of original aesthetics. Neglecting the functional condition undermines its role as a functional object and increases the risk of electrical hazards, thereby diminishing its appeal to collectors and users alike.

6. Rarity Factor

6. Rarity Factor, Vintage Lamps

The rarity factor significantly influences the valuation and collectibility of antique light sources exhibiting a verdant coloration. Limited production numbers, unique design characteristics, and historical significance contribute to a lamp’s scarcity, thereby elevating its desirability among collectors and enthusiasts. The interplay between these elements creates a demand that outstrips supply, resulting in increased market value and a heightened appreciation for the lamp’s unique qualities. A green slag glass lamp produced for a limited time by a specific manufacturer, for instance, acquires substantial value due to its scarcity and distinctive aesthetic.

Frequently Asked Questions about Antique Emerald Lighting Fixtures

The following questions and answers address common inquiries regarding the identification, valuation, and care of vintage light sources featuring green coloration.

Question 1: How can one determine the approximate age of a green vintage lamp?

The age determination process involves several considerations. Examining the lamp’s design style, materials used, and any identifying marks is crucial. Consulting historical catalogs, researching manufacturers’ timelines, and comparing the lamp to documented examples can provide additional clues. A qualified appraiser may offer expert analysis.

Question 2: What factors influence the value of antique verdant lamps?

The value of such a lighting fixture is determined by factors including its age, rarity, condition, design aesthetics, and provenance. Lamps manufactured by renowned makers, those in excellent original condition, and those with documented historical significance tend to command higher prices.

Question 3: What are common signs of damage to look for when assessing these lamps?

Common signs of damage include cracks in glass or ceramic components, corrosion on metal parts, deterioration of wiring, and fading or discoloration of the green finish. The structural integrity of the base and shade should also be examined.

Question 4: How should a green vintage lamp be cleaned and maintained?

Cleaning requires a gentle approach. A soft, dry cloth is generally sufficient for removing dust. Avoid harsh chemicals or abrasive cleaners that could damage the finish. Professional cleaning and restoration services should be considered for more extensive cleaning needs.

Question 5: Is it safe to use the original wiring in an antique verdant lamp?

Using original wiring is strongly discouraged due to potential safety hazards. Over time, the insulation can become brittle and cracked, increasing the risk of electrical shock or fire. Professional rewiring with modern, insulated wires is recommended.

Question 6: How can one authenticate a purported Tiffany green glass lamp?

Authenticating a Tiffany lamp requires careful examination. Look for the signature “Tiffany Studios” or related markings. Inspect the glass for its characteristic quality and coloration. Consult with experts specializing in Tiffany lamps to verify authenticity.
